Opening glance: major beverage stocks mixed
updated 10:01 a.m. ET May 13, 2008
Font size:

NEW YORK - Major beverage stocks were mixed Tuesday morning after the Commerce Department reported a drop in retail sales in April. Excluding auto sales, however, results were better than economists had expected.

How shares of some major beverage makers performed just after the opening bell:

Molson Coors Brewing Co. fell 26 cents to $56.80.

Anheuser-Busch Cos. added 30 cents to $51.91.

Coca-Cola Co. rose 10 cents to $56.50.

PepsiCo Inc. fell 7 cents to $67.28.
